It depends. Your author could have written you more than one. Your original author could have defaulted but still managed to get a story posted, and you got a pinch hit written. Or someone could have seen a prompt they liked on the Yuletide Madness list (where all prompts are thrown open to everyone) and written a story for it.

One year my author defaulted, and I got like 5 stories.
